What is the 2009 IECC Arkansas Compliance Checklist?
The 2009 IECC Arkansas Compliance Checklist is a crucial tool that assists builders and code officials in ensuring compliance with the 2009 International Energy Conservation Code (IECC). This checklist serves to document the energy efficiency measures being implemented in construction projects throughout Arkansas. It is primarily used by builders and contractors during the construction phase to verify that all energy efficiency requirements are met, making it an essential document for maintaining regulatory standards.
Code officials rely on this form for inspections, ensuring that the buildings being constructed are up to code and sustainable. The checklist helps facilitate adherence to energy regulations, ultimately supporting Arkansas's efforts towards energy conservation.

Key Features of the 2009 IECC Arkansas Compliance Checklist
The checklist is designed with user-friendliness in mind, featuring fillable checkboxes for various aspects of compliance, including:
-
Foundation
-
Framing
-
HVAC Systems
-
Electrical Components
-
Insulation
Additionally, it contains sections for notes and code references, facilitating comprehensive documentation throughout the inspection process. This level of detail ensures that all necessary compliance verification steps are recorded efficiently.
Who Needs the 2009 IECC Arkansas Compliance Checklist?
The primary audience for the 2009 IECC Arkansas Compliance Checklist includes builders, contractors, and code officials in Arkansas. Each group plays a critical role in the compliance process:
-
Builders must accurately complete the checklist during construction.
-
Contractors are responsible for implementing the measures that meet energy efficiency standards.
-
Code officials inspect the completed forms to ensure all practices align with state regulations.
Understanding their roles and responsibilities ensures effective collaboration towards achieving energy code compliance in Arkansas.
